This review is only for the Pecan Pie which is incredibly delicious. We bought the smaller one as we've never tried their Pecan Pie. We will definitely be buying the regular size soon. The Pecan Pie is a 2023 winner at the National Pie Championships! We've eaten several types of their pies in the past and they're all delicious. The Cherry Pie, Pumpkin Pie and The Berry Bomb were all 2023 winners in their divisions. You can order the pies online or at many Farmers Markets or some grocery stores. I would highly recommend giving them a try.

After sampling a number of pies from Northern California area bakeries, Beckmann's is the best. The fillings are great, especially the peach in the summer and pumpkin in the fall, but the crust...the crust!! All-butter and perfect flaky texture. The cookies are great, too.
